Facility Evaluation Report
On 2/24/26, at 1:30pm,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Perry Scott conducted an unannounced required annual inspection visit to New Villa-Monarch. LPA met with Jennifer Villanueva, Administrator, and the purpose of today’s visit was explained. The facility is licensed to serve six (6) non- ambulatory residents (age 60 and over). Currently, the home has (0) residents. The facility has an approved hospice waiver for (5) residents. The facility’s annual fees are current.
The facility is a single-story building located in a residential neighborhood. It consists of the following: three (3) bedrooms, two (2) bathrooms, living room, dining room, kitchen, laundry area, garage, and an outside patio area.
At 1:55pm, LPA and staff toured the facility. There are no bodies of water or firearm/ammunition on the premises. All resident rooms were checked. Beds and bedding were in good condition, adequate lighting provided, and adequate storage for resident personal belongings was observed. Walls and floors were in good repair. Bed linens, comforters, and bath towels were adequately stocked at the time of visit. Bathrooms were found to be within Title 22 regulations. Toilets and water faucets worked properly. The shower was free of mold/mildew, there was adequate lighting, and sufficient toiletries were accessible to clients. The water temperature measured 114.8F. A comfortable temperature is maintained in the facility.
